1

「アクティビティ」および「参加者」コンテンツ タイプを作成した「アクティビティ管理」サイトを作成しています。「参加者」コンテンツ タイプには氏名、セル番号、電子メール、住所フィールドがあり、「活動」にはタイトル、場所、時間、活動参加者 (「参加者」コンテンツ タイプのエンティティ参照フィールド) があります。アクティビティの参加者を追加/削除できる「アクティビティ マネージャー」ロールを作成しました。アクティビティ q=node/(view/display) ページに、「アクティビティ マネージャー」が 1- 新しい参加者を追加 2- 既存の参加者からアクティビティに追加できる 2 つのボタンを追加したいと考えています。私はインラインエンティティフォーム、エンティティフォームをいじりましたが、運がありませんでした。インラインエンティティフォームはそれを行いますが、q=node/view からではなくノード/(追加/編集) ページで行います。

4

1 に答える 1

0

これは、エンティティ参照の事前入力モジュールと表示スイートまたはパネルを使用して行うことができます。パネルについてはよくわかりませんが、動的フィールドを追加し、エンティティ参照事前設定モジュール ( https://www.drupal.org/project/entityreference_prepopulate ) を使用することで、ディスプレイ スイートでこれを行うことができます。entityreference prepopulate 実装のコード空手のスクリーンキャスト ( https://www.youtube.com/watch?v=z9C4Uf6euLY ) を見ることができます (ここでこのソリューションを入手しました)。

お役に立てれば!

于 2016-01-05T10:14:21.527 に答える